100 Mercedes-Benz dealers to sell Sprinter starting Jan. 2010

100 Mercedes-Benz dealers to sell Sprinter starting Jan. 2010

Mercedes-Benz USA announced that 100 dealers have accepted its offer to sell the Springer van in U.S. showrooms starting January. Daimler AG said in September that it will yank the Sprinter from Chrysler and its Dodge dealerships by Jan. 2010. Chrysler to replace Sprinter with Fiat Ducato, Iveco in the U.S.

Chrysler to replace Sprinter with Fiat Ducato, Iveco in the U.S.

Earlier this morning we learned that Mercedes-Benz is yanking its Sprinter from Chrysler and its Dodge dealerships by Jan. 2010. Chrysler Group LLC has now confirmed that it is considering two Fiat SpA commercial vehicles for the North American market to replace the Sprinter.
